hls-performance-thesis/code/fpga/ndrange_results/proteins.15MB.len6/run4.json
2021-07-03 17:59:32 +02:00

1 line
No EOL
5.7 KiB
JSON

{"power": [{"timestamp": 36.9855, "power": 35.028442}, {"timestamp": 57.6555, "power": 35.028442}, {"timestamp": 78.1855, "power": 35.028442}, {"timestamp": 98.7172, "power": 35.028442}, {"timestamp": 119.578, "power": 35.028442}, {"timestamp": 140.458, "power": 35.028442}, {"timestamp": 160.98, "power": 35.028442}, {"timestamp": 181.521, "power": 35.028442}, {"timestamp": 202.06, "power": 35.028442}, {"timestamp": 222.612, "power": 35.028442}, {"timestamp": 243.15, "power": 35.028442}, {"timestamp": 263.687, "power": 35.028442}, {"timestamp": 284.198, "power": 35.028442}, {"timestamp": 304.689, "power": 35.028442}, {"timestamp": 325.172, "power": 35.028442}, {"timestamp": 345.688, "power": 35.028442}, {"timestamp": 366.154, "power": 35.028442}, {"timestamp": 386.48, "power": 35.028442}, {"timestamp": 406.944, "power": 35.028442}, {"timestamp": 427.259, "power": 35.028442}, {"timestamp": 447.717, "power": 35.028442}, {"timestamp": 468.145, "power": 35.028442}, {"timestamp": 488.606, "power": 35.028442}, {"timestamp": 509.046, "power": 35.028442}, {"timestamp": 529.492, "power": 35.028442}, {"timestamp": 549.938, "power": 35.028442}, {"timestamp": 570.422, "power": 35.028442}, {"timestamp": 590.954, "power": 35.028442}, {"timestamp": 611.446, "power": 35.028442}, {"timestamp": 631.97, "power": 35.028442}, {"timestamp": 652.484, "power": 35.028442}, {"timestamp": 672.978, "power": 35.028442}, {"timestamp": 693.508, "power": 35.028442}, {"timestamp": 714.018, "power": 35.028442}, {"timestamp": 734.519, "power": 35.028442}, {"timestamp": 755.052, "power": 35.028442}, {"timestamp": 775.589, "power": 35.028442}, {"timestamp": 796.142, "power": 35.028442}, {"timestamp": 816.636, "power": 35.028442}, {"timestamp": 837.171, "power": 35.028442}, {"timestamp": 857.709, "power": 35.028442}, {"timestamp": 878.235, "power": 35.028442}, {"timestamp": 898.759, "power": 35.028442}, {"timestamp": 919.289, "power": 35.028442}, {"timestamp": 939.819, "power": 35.028442}, {"timestamp": 960.33, "power": 35.028442}, {"timestamp": 980.821, "power": 35.028442}, {"timestamp": 1001.34, "power": 35.028442}, {"timestamp": 1021.86, "power": 35.620095}, {"timestamp": 1043.01, "power": 35.620095}, {"timestamp": 1063.56, "power": 35.620095}, {"timestamp": 1084.14, "power": 35.620095}, {"timestamp": 1104.82, "power": 35.620095}, {"timestamp": 1125.35, "power": 35.620095}, {"timestamp": 1145.93, "power": 35.620095}, {"timestamp": 1166.48, "power": 35.620095}], "timeline": {"START": "566.00994", "END": "842.739285"}, "OpenCL API Calls": [{"name": "clFinish", "calls": 1, "time": 600.739}, {"name": "clReleaseKernel", "calls": 1, "time": 171.982}, {"name": "clSetKernelArg", "calls": 19, "time": 165.357}, {"name": "clCreateProgramWithBinary", "calls": 1, "time": 63.8762}, {"name": "clReleaseContext", "calls": 1, "time": 43.5001}, {"name": "clCreateContext", "calls": 1, "time": 34.8303}, {"name": "clReleaseProgram", "calls": 1, "time": 20.2124}, {"name": "clEnqueueMigrateMemObjects", "calls": 2, "time": 0.539921}, {"name": "clCreateKernel", "calls": 1, "time": 0.339752}, {"name": "clEnqueueNDRangeKernel", "calls": 1, "time": 0.160838}, {"name": "clReleaseMemObject", "calls": 21, "time": 0.073617}, {"name": "clRetainMemObject", "calls": 14, "time": 0.036964}, {"name": "clGetExtensionFunctionAddress", "calls": 1, "time": 0.031589}, {"name": "clCreateBuffer", "calls": 7, "time": 0.023243}, {"name": "clReleaseDevice", "calls": 2, "time": 0.023065}, {"name": "clReleaseCommandQueue", "calls": 1, "time": 0.013985}, {"name": "clGetPlatformInfo", "calls": 4, "time": 0.010444}, {"name": "clGetExtensionFunctionAddressForPlatform", "calls": 1, "time": 0.009031}, {"name": "clCreateCommandQueue", "calls": 1, "time": 0.007073}, {"name": "clGetDeviceIDs", "calls": 2, "time": 0.00647}, {"name": "clRetainDevice", "calls": 2, "time": 0.004656}], "Kernel Execution": [{"kernel": "fmindex", "enqueues": 1, "time": 276.729}], "Compute Unit Utilization": [{"cu": "fmindex_1", "kernel": "fmindex", "time": 217.486}, {"cu": "fmindex_2", "kernel": "fmindex", "time": 235.198}, {"cu": "fmindex_3", "kernel": "fmindex", "time": 254.713}, {"cu": "fmindex_4", "kernel": "fmindex", "time": 276.273}, {"cu": "fmindex_5", "kernel": "fmindex", "time": 240.851}], "Data Transfer: Host to Global Memory": [{"type": "READ", "transfers": 1, "speed": 8721.493478, "utilization": 90.84889, "size": 480060.0, "time": 55.043325}, {"type": "WRITE", "transfers": 1, "speed": 6378.673974, "utilization": 66.444521, "size": 1714470.0, "time": 268.781115}], "Data Transfer: Kernels to Global Memory": [{"interface": "DDR[1:3]", "type": "READ", "transfers": 682428, "speed": 29.802, "utilization": 0.258698,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 35696, "speed": 370.819, "utilization": 3.21891, "size": 0.11872}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 737476, "speed": 29.7651, "utilization": 0.258378,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 39073, "speed": 372.126, "utilization": 3.23026, "size": 0.1195}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 802548, "speed": 29.9335, "utilization": 0.25984,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 43198, "speed": 375.096, "utilization": 3.25604, "size": 0.120312}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 873502, "speed": 30.0647, "utilization": 0.260978,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 47648, "speed": 376.493, "utilization": 3.26817, "size": 0.121066}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 759345, "speed": 29.9727, "utilization": 0.26018,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 40458, "speed": 373.56, "utilization": 3.24271, "size": 0.119817}]}